AI for Reporting Automation (2026)

Recurring reports (weekly metrics, monthly board updates, quarterly business reviews) consume disproportionate ops time when generated manually. AI-augmented platforms now schedule, generate, and distribute reports with AI-written commentary and chart annotations on top of raw numbers. Rows ships spreadsheet-driven scheduled reports with AI commentary; Julius AI generates narrative-rich reports from data uploads; Deepnote handles notebook-driven scheduled reports; Akkio and Formula Bot focus on AutoML and formula-driven automation.

What reports benefit most from AI automation?
Recurring reports with stable structure: weekly KPI dashboards, monthly board metrics, weekly team summaries. Anything generated more than 4 times per year is automation-worthy. One-off reports rarely justify the setup time.
Rows vs Deepnote for reporting?
Rows is spreadsheet-native and faster for non-technical operators; Deepnote is notebook-native and stronger for analyst-heavy workflows with code-driven transformations. Operators pick Rows; analysts pick Deepnote.
Can AI write report commentary?
For descriptive commentary (this metric went up X%, this segment outperformed), yes with high accuracy. For causal claims and strategic recommendations, AI overstates confidence; always edit before sending to executives or boards.
